Output 2e390b988c60913a79b8773aaac974a2505688443a11a4e86ea081287d621ee0:0

value
1131051778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9314b1c0bfa9429708e6c6bd0ea9a8ee5f5000c OP_EQUAL
address
3QQdEGtbdh6xhmukF82YaUTzEaPzWZ37Wq
transaction
2e390b988c60913a79b8773aaac974a2505688443a11a4e86ea081287d621ee0
spent
true